What is the average cost of Tar and Gravel Roofing?

+-

The average cost of Tar and Gravel Roofing in the USA typically ranges from $3 to $6 per square foot, but this can vary significantly based on local factors such as the cost of living, material availability, and the complexity of your roof. In regions with heavy snowfall or extreme weather, additional reinforcements may be needed, increasing costs. Always consider obtaining multiple quotes from local contractors to get a more accurate estimate for your specific situation.

The installation of Tar and Gravel Roofing typically takes between one to three days,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Weather conditions can also impact the timeline, especially in regions with unpredictable climates. A professional contractor can provide a more accurate estimate based on your specific project.

What are the main benefits of investing in Tar and Gravel Roofing?

+-

Tar and Gravel Roofing offers excellent durability and weather resistance, making it ideal for flat or low-slope roofs, especially in areas with heavy rainfall or snow. It provides good insulation and can help reduce energy costs. Additionally, the gravel layer protects the underlying materials from UV damage and extends the roof's lifespan.

How often should Tar and Gravel Roofing be performed or checked?

+-

Tar and Gravel Roofing should be inspected at least once a year, especially after severe weather events. Regular maintenance can help identify potential issues early and prolong the roof's lifespan. In areas with extreme weather conditions, more frequent inspections may be necessary to ensure the roof remains in good condition.
